In these challenging economic times, it is critical for organizations to optimize the use of their resources. None more so than their human resource. That capacity is principally determined by the effectiveness of leadership. Our program will enable supervisors and managers with the self-management and people leadership knowledge, attitudes and skills to engender the enthusiastic participation of their people in successfully responding to the realities of our present business environment.
 
As a participant, you will:

·Understand the difference between leadership and management

·Learn the dimensions and roles of leadership

·Have the awareness and skills set to match leadership style with follower-readiness

·Understand the relationship between leadership and employee morale and performance, and service excellence

·Have the essential knowledge and desire to develop the skills and habits of the emotionally intelligent leader

·Be able to develop and effectively lead consistently high-performing individuals and teams
